Why Fort Lauderdale for Retirement

The Retirement Case in Plain English

Fort Lauderdale offers retirees something genuinely rare: a city that feels like a real place — with culture, restaurants, arts, and community — that also happens to have perfect weather, zero income tax on all retirement income, and world-class healthcare within 30 minutes. It’s not a retirement community or a resort town. It’s a thriving American city that happens to be one of the best places in the country to retire.

Florida taxes no retirement income of any kind — not Social Security, not pension distributions, not 401(k) or IRA withdrawals. For a retired couple drawing $180,000 per year from retirement accounts, moving from New Jersey or New York to Florida saves $12,000–$18,000 annually. Over a 25-year retirement, that’s $300,000–$450,000 in retained wealth before any investment return.

Florida also has no state estate tax, making it one of the most favorable states in the country for intergenerational wealth transfer. The Save Our Homes Act caps annual property tax increases at 3% once you establish primary residence — protecting you as your neighborhood appreciates.

Best Neighborhoods for Retirees

Where Fort Lauderdale Retirees Are Choosing to Live

Galt Mile — Best for Condo Lifestyle Retirees
Oceanfront high-rises with pools, fitness centers, social rooms, and concierge services — everything within the building. Walk to restaurants and the beach along the Galt Mile corridor. Minimal maintenance responsibility. The most popular area in Fort Lauderdale for retirement condos, with a strong established community of retirees and active social calendars year-round.
Coral Ridge — Best Single-Family Neighborhood for Retirees
Established, quiet, and waterfront. Many retirees downsize from their Northeast family home to a Coral Ridge canal-front home — losing the maintenance burden while gaining a private dock and permanent connection to Fort Lauderdale’s waterway system. Mature trees, quiet streets, and a residential character that rewards long-term residents.
Victoria Park — Best for Active Walkable Retirement
Walk to Las Olas restaurants and shops, morning walks through tree-canopied streets, a vibrant community of long-term residents. Victoria Park attracts active retirees who want city energy without the city density — urban lifestyle with a neighborhood pace.
Imperial Point or Harbour Isles — Best Value for Retirees
Established neighborhoods with accessible entry points, waterfront access, and quiet residential character. Popular with retirees who want Fort Lauderdale lifestyle without paying Rio Vista or Harbor Beach prices.
Healthcare

World-Class Medical Care Near Every Fort Lauderdale Neighborhood

Cleveland Clinic Florida in Weston (30 minutes from most Fort Lauderdale neighborhoods) is consistently ranked among the best hospitals in the country by U.S. News & World Report. Full specialty care, cardiac surgery, cancer treatment, and preventive medicine at the level Cleveland Clinic is known for nationally.

Holy Cross Health in Fort Lauderdale is a highly regarded regional medical center with strong cardiac and orthopedic programs. Broward Health Medical Center serves as the primary downtown hospital. Florida is one of the strongest states for Medicare Advantage plan options — the large, affluent retiree population drives strong insurer competition and typically among the highest number of plan choices in the country.

Mayo Clinic Access

The Mayo Clinic Jacksonville campus is 3.5 hours north for specialized care. The combination of Cleveland Clinic Florida, Holy Cross, and access to Mayo means Fort Lauderdale retirees have healthcare options that rival most major metropolitan areas.

Common Questions

What Retirees Ask Before Making the Move

Will my pension be taxed in Florida?
No. Florida does not tax pension income of any kind — government pensions, corporate pensions, military pensions, or annuity payments. All retirement income is exempt from Florida state tax.
What about the summer heat?
Fort Lauderdale summers (June–September) are hot and humid with afternoon thunderstorms that typically clear by evening. Most retirees develop a rhythm: outdoor activities in the morning and evening, air-conditioned spaces midday. Many spend part of summer visiting family in the Northeast, returning in October when the weather becomes spectacular again.
